Fire response to dog stuck in recliner at home, Waldoboro ME


Fire department responded to a home near Clary Hill Rd to assist a dog stuck in a recliner. The dog was upstairs in the garage and appeared anxious. The callers were holding the chair up to prevent the dog from getting injured further.
